I emailed this entry to my lord, who does this for a living, and he replied:

Developers who create automated unit tests for their code, before it even arrives in the hands of the Test group, realize the scope, complexity, and sheer creativity necessary to produce good test automation.

A good book on automated unit testing, which also applies to further functional test automation, is "xUnit Test Patterns: Refactoring Test Code" by Gerard Meszaros
